Definitions:

Psychiatric Forensic

A field of study and practice at the intersection of mental health and the legal system, involving the assessment and treatment of individuals within the criminal justice system.

Mental State

The condition of someone's mental and emotional health at a particular time, often assessed through mood, behavior, and cognitive functions.

Forensic Nurse Examiner

A specialized nurse who provides care to victims of crime, collects evidence, and may testify in court about medical findings.

Expert Witness

An individual with specialized knowledge or expertise in a particular field, called upon to testify in court cases or legal matters.
